This paper proposes an algorithm which maps the position of a catheter tip on a fluorograph to the 3D position in magnetic resonance angiography (MRA) data. This algorithm was assessed for its accuracy. We designed an algorithm consisting of a registration step and a recognition step. The registration step registers MRA and fluorography data using a digital subtraction angiography (DSA) image. The recognition step recognizes the position in the MRA data corresponding to the catheter tip position on a fluorograph. We checked the accuracy of the recognition step by employing an artificial data set consisting of 3D image data (64 x 64 x 64 matrix) and its projection image (92 x 92 matrix) and the accuracy of the registration step with the aid of three of the 3D time-of-flight MRA data sets (256 x 256 matrix and 60 slices) and their projection images in the form of DSA images. The accuracy of the recognition step depended upon that of the registration. When there was no misregistration, all of the mean errors were less than 0.2 mm. The mean errors of the registration step were 0.273 mm and 0.226 mm, respectively, for the longitudinal shift along the X and Y axes, 0.478 degrees, 1.203 degrees and 0.208 degrees, respectively, for the rotation angles around the X, Y and Z axes and 0.020 times for the magnification. The mean image error between the projection image of the registered MRA data and that of the MRA data which were employed as the DSA image was 0.034 mm.  相似文献

Chimeric simian and human immunodeficiency viruses (SHIVs) are useful for investigating the pathogenicity of human immunodeficiency virus (HIV-1) and to develop an anti-HIV-1 vaccine. We attempted to construct SHIVs containing Env from various subtypes, because almost all SHIVs which have been reported so far have Env from HIV-1 that belongs to subtype B. Two infectious SHIVs containing Env from two strains of HIV-1, CMR304 and CMR306, which belong to subtype F and A, respectively, were newly obtained. These SHIVs essentially showed a coreceptor usage and a neutralization pattern that were similar to those of the parental HIV-1s. In macaque PBMC, SHIVcmr304 replicated with kinetics similar to that of prototypic SHIV-NM-3rN with HIV-1 NL432 Env, but SHIVcmr306 replicated poorly. Inoculation of four rhesus macaques with SHIVcmr304 resulted in an increase of plasma viral load in all the macaques, though viral RNA copies were 100-fold lower than that in the infection with NM-3rN. This SHIV containing Env from HIV-1 subtype F will be a valuable source for the analysis of HIV-1 subtype F and the evaluation of vaccine candidates as a genetically divergent challenge virus.  相似文献

An anomalous case of the right subclavian artery arising from the aortic arch as the last branch, in which the first branch was the right common carotid, the second the left common carotid and the third the left subclavian artery, was found in a 10 months human fetus among 173 fetuses. The right subclavian artery arose from the posterior wall of the aortic arch at the level of the Th4 and passed obliquely between the esophagus and the thoracic vertebrae. The right and the left vertebral arteries arising from the subclavian arteries on the same side entered the transverse foramen of the C6 of each side. This case belonged to type G of Adachi's classification and as well type 5 of Holzapfel's. The present authors wish to offer a new trial classification on these variations, including the origins and numbers of the vertebral arteries, by investigating many original reports in Japanese, as follows: 1) A new classification is fixed on the basis of the type G and H of Adachi-Williams et al.-Nakagawa in the classification of the branching types of the aortic arch. The type G represents that the right common carotid, the left common carotid, the left subclavian and the right subclavian arteries arise from the aortic arch in this order. The type H represents that the bicarotid trunk, the left subclavian and the right subclavian arteries arise from the aortic arch. 2) When the left vertebral artery arising from the aortic arch is found in the type G and H, "C" is prefixed G or H, as type CG, type CH. 3) When the right vertebral artery arising from the right common carotid artery is found, a prime mark, "', is put on G or H, as type G', type H'. 4) In order to represent a compound type of the above 2) and 3), both "C" and "' are put, as type CG', type CH'. 5) When the bilateral vertebral arteries arising from the respective subclavian artery are found in the above 2), 3) and 4) "2" postfixed "C" and the prime mark "', as type G'2, type C2G, type CG'2, type C2G', type C2G'2, type H'2, type C2H, type CH'2, type C2H', type C2H'2. According to the above new classification, Adachi's type G can be arranged into 18 branching types. This classification may be helpful and sufficient to provide more than 100 cases of the type G and H reported on Japanese.(ABSTRACT TRUNCATED AT 250 WORDS)  相似文献

Previously we reported disease-specific interaction between interferon- (IFN-) and interleukin-4 (IL-4) in patients with IgA nephropathy (IgAN), suggesting the existence of unusual T cell behavior in this disease. In the present study, we investigated characteristic synthesis of interferon- (IFN-) and expression of IFN- receptor (IFN-R) in the peripheral blood mononuclear cells (PBMC) from patients with IgAN and other chronic proliferative glomerulonephritis (PGN). Heparinized peripheral blood samples were obtained from 38 patients with chronic mesangial proliferative glomerulonephritis (CGN; including 24 with IgA nephropathy) and 20 healthy controls. PBMC were isolated by gradient centrifugation and fragments were cultured in Iscove's modified Dulbecco's medium (IMDM) supplemented with 10% fetal calf serum (FCS) for 72 hr. IFN- concentrations in supernatants were evaluated by the enzyme-linked immunosorbent assay (ELISA). Other parts of PBMC pellets were reacted with anti-human IFN-R monoclonal antibody and FITC-labeled anti-mouse second antibody for analysis of IFN-R expression on these cells by FACScan. The remaining PBMC were fractionated into CD4+ T cells, CD8+ T cells, B cells, NK, cells and macrophages using the MACS cell sorting system. The isolated cells were evaluated for IFN- or IFN-R mRNA expression by the semiquantitative RT-PCR method.In vitro IFN- synthesis was enhanced in patients with CGN, and NK cells were revealed to be responsible for such enhancement. On the other hand, the expression of IFN-R on macrophages was suppressed in CGN patients. These results suggest that impairment of regulation of the IFN- system might be involved in the development of CGN.  相似文献

The psychomotor stimulant methamphetamine (METH) has been shown to cause specific behaviors such as hyperlocomotion in rodents. Pretreatment of repeated s.c. administration of clorgyline (1 mg/kg, once per day for 5 consecutive days), a monoamine oxidase (MAO)-A inhibitor, blocked hyperlocomotion induced by a single i.p. administration of METH (1 mg/kg) in male ICR mice, without any effect on spontaneous locomotion. The blockade was also observed when mice were pretreated with a single administration of clorgyline (1 mg/kg, s.c.), without potentiating hyperlocomotion and rearing induced by a single challenge of METH at the range of 0.5-2 mg/kg (i.p.). In contrast, single or repeated pretreatment of selegiline (0.3 mg/kg, s.c.), a MAO-B inhibitor, had no effect on METH-induced hyperlocomotion. Clorgyline pretreatment, both single and repeated, altered the effects of single METH challenges on apparent 5-hydroxytryptamine (serotonin) turnover in the region of the striatum and accumbens. These results suggest that clorgyline tends to oppose METH-induced hyperlocomotion through alteration of the serotonergic system in the region of the striatum and accumbens.  相似文献

"Essential laboratory tests" advocated by Japan Society of Clinical Pathology were simultaneously performed with the history taking of the present illness and the physical examination in 1,026 new patients visited the outpatient unit of Comprehensive Medicine, National Defense Medical College. We have analyzed the usefulness of the "essential laboratory tests" for the establishment of the initial diagnosis in evaluable 750 patients by comparing the diagnosis made only by the history taking and the physical examination (tentative initial diagnosis) with that included the results of these laboratory tests. The "essential laboratory tests" had contributed to remarkably increased incidences of metabolic and endocrine diseases, liver or biliary tract diseases, renal and urinary tract diseases and anemia after the application of these tests. The initial diagnoses of 61 patients were successfully established by the addition of the "essential laboratory tests" among 157 cases of which tentative initial diagnoses remained undetermined. These tests confirmed the tentative diagnoses in 78 patients, while 78 tentative diagnoses were negated and corrected after evaluation of the results of these tests. Furthermore, the diagnostic tests such as CRP and leukocyte count were useful for the estimation of the nature or degree of seriousness of the disease in 57 patients. In addition, other diseases not related to the patient's chief complaint could be detected in 238 patients (303 total number of diseases) by these tests. These results indicate the usefulness of the "essential laboratory tests" not only for the establishment of more accurate initial diagnosis but also for the screening of the "hidden" diseases such as hyperlipidemia and liver dysfunction.  相似文献

To investigate how cerebellar synaptic plasticity guides the acquisition and adaptation of ocular following response (OFR), a large-scale network model was developed. The model includes the cerebral medial superior temporal area (MST), Purkinje cells (P cells) of the ventral paraflocculus, the accessory optic and climbing fiber systems, the brain stem oculomotor network, and the oculomotor plant. The model reconstructed temporal profiles of both firing patterns of MST neurons and P cells and eye movements. Model MST neurons (n = 1,080) were set to be driven by retinal error and exhibited 12 preferred directions, 30 preferred velocities, and 3 firing waveforms. Correspondingly, each model P cell contained 1,080 excitatory synapses from granule cell axons (GCA) and 1,080 inhibitory synapses. P cells (n = 40) were classified into four groups by their laterality (hemisphere) and by preferred directions of their climbing fiber inputs (CF) (contralateral or upward). The brain stem neural circuit and the oculomotor plant were modeled on the work of Yamamoto et al. The initial synaptic weights on the P cells were set randomly. At the beginning, P cell simple spikes were not well modulated by visual motion, and the eye was moved only slightly by the accessory optic system. The synaptic weights were updated according to integral-differential equation models of physiologically demonstrated synaptic plasticity: long-term depression and long-term potentiation for GCA synapses and rebound potentiation for inhibitory synapses. We assumed that maximum plasticity was induced when GCA inputs preceded CF inputs by 200 ms. After more than 10,000 presentations of ramp-step visual motion, the strengths of both the excitatory and inhibitory synapses were modified. Subsequently, the simple spike responses became well developed, and ordinary OFRs were acquired. The preferred directions of simple spikes became the opposite of those of CFs. Although the model MST neurons were set to possess a wide variety of firing characteristics, the model P cells acquired only downward or ipsilateral preferred directions, high preferred velocities and stereotypical firing waveforms. Therefore the drastic transition of the neural representation from the population codes in the MST to the firing-rate codes of simple spikes were learned at the GCA-P cell synapses and inhibitory cells-P cell synapses. Furthermore, the model successfully reproduced the gain- and directional-adaptation of OFR, which was demonstrated by manipulating the velocity and direction of visual motion, respectively. When we assumed that synaptic plasticity could only occur if CF inputs preceded GCA inputs, the ordinary OFR were acquired but neither the gain-adaptation nor the directional adaptation could be reproduced.  相似文献

To monitor the presence of genotypic HIV-1 variants circulating in eastern Cameroon, blood samples from 57 HIV-1-infected individuals attending 3 local health centers in the bordering rural villages with Central African Republic (CAR) were collected and analyzed phylogenetically. Out of the 40 HIV-1 strains with positive polymerase chain reaction (PCR) profile for both gag and env-C2V3,12 (30.0%) had discordant subtype or CRF designation: 2 subtype B/A (gag/env), 1 B/CRF01, 2 B/CRF02, 1 CRF01/CRF01.A, 2 CRF11/CRF01, 1 CRF13/A, 1 CRF13/CRF01, 1 CRF13/CRF11, and 1 G/U (unclassified). Twenty-eight strains (70.0%) had concordant subtypes or CRF designation between gag and env: 27 subtype A and 1 F2. Out of the remaining 17HIV-1 strains negative for PCR with the env-C2V3 primers used, 10 (58.8%) had discordant subtype or CRF, and 7 (41.2%) had concordant one based on gag/pol/env-gp41 analysis. Altogether, a high proportion (22/57, 38.6%) of the isolates were found to be recombinant strains. In addition, an emergence of new forms of HIV-1 strains, such as subtype B/A (gag/env), B/CRF01 and B/CRF02, was identified. The epidemiologic pattern of HIV-1 in eastern Cameroon, relatively low and high prevalence of CRF02 and CRF11, respectively, was more closely related to those of CAR and Chad than that of other regions of Cameroon, where CRF02 is the most predominant HIV-1 strain. These findings strongly suggest that this part of Cameroon is a potential hotspot of HIV-1 recombination, with a likelihood of an active generation of new forms of HIV-1 variants, though epidemiologic significance of new HIV-1 forms is unknown.  相似文献

 This study characterizes the developmental expression of NADPH-diaphorase from embryo to adulthood in the forebrain, midbrain and cerebellum of rat brain via histochemical staining. On embryonic day 12 no neurons stained. Labeling was observed in certain nuclei from E15 through the postnatal period to adulthood. Labeling in neurons increased or maintained a constant level with increased age. The embryo demonstrated substantial labeling in neurons of the caudate putamen, bed nucleus of the stria terminalis, preoptic area, lateral hypothalamic area, paraventricular thalamic nucleus, ventromedial hypothalamic nucleus, magnocellular nucleus posterior commissure, and periaqueductal central gray. Additional neuronal labeling was observed postnatally in the olfactory bulb, cerebral cortex, amygdala, various nuclei of the thalamus, interpeduncular nucleus, linear nucleus of the raphe, pretectal area and superior colliculus. In the cerebellum, labeling appeared only after P14 in cells of the molecular cell layer and granular cell layer. The sizes of labeled neurons developed significantly from P4 to P14 in several nuclei. The distinctive temporal and spatial expression pattern of NADPH-diaphorase implies that the NO/cGMP system may play an important role in physiological and developmental functions.
